      This is my first model in sketchup. The most of my building's walls are curved. When I started modelling I thought that it would be nice to have as smooth curves as I could, so I changed the number of segments in my curves to 200. Now, after a week I have a very heavy model so I have every floor in an other file in order to avoid lagging.

      As I changed the number of segments, I now have about 50 walls with 200 faces on every wall. It will take one day just for applying a texture. And if I want to change something I have to redo everything.

      If I apply the texture to the whole group, then it is not being applied smoothly. I hope that I made my issue clear now.

        Try this (you may be lucky):

        1. reveal hidden geometry and position the texture on one facet
        2. sample the positioned material from this facet (Alt+Paint tool)
        3. hide hidden geometry (now all your curved wall can be selected with a single click) and apply the sampled (and positioned) material onto the whole surface.

        As for painting groups: of course it does not work. Please, have a look at this tutorial.

                If I were you I would redraw the walls with fewer edges/faces. As you say, the walls you've got have already made your model quite heavy and as you add textures it will only get heavier. This is likely to cause you more problems that just applying materials to those walls as you go. I think the time spent correcting the model will be worth it in reduced time spent adding materials and making repairs and so on.

                One of these was drawn with the default 12-segment arc. The other is 200 segments. Is the 200 sided one really all that much smoother than the 12?
                curves.png

                Even with textures and shadows I don't think there's enough difference to show.
